Steven Drozd Departs The Flaming Lips

Steven Drozd has departed the Flaming Lips after 33 years of creating the psychedelic magic we've come to love. From his mesmerizing keyboard wizardry to his multi-instrumental genius, Steven has been the sonic backbone of one of rock's most innovative bands.

But after years of tension and some very public drama, the Oklahoma freaks have lost their mad scientist. Without Steven's playing to support the bombastic nature of the Flaming Lips we have known in the past, Wayne's bit definitely wear thin. LCD Soundsystem | Knockdown Center | Queens, NY

A live concert review of LCD Soundsystem's second night at their annual residency at the Knockdown Center in Queens, New York. This was my fifteenth LCD Soundsystem show, and like every time before, the precision and magnitude of their live setup continues to amaze.

From the opener Public Circuit's killer percussion-driven set to LCD's visually intense performance, this night showcased why they remain one of the most compelling live acts. Plus, my ongoing quest to understand their master clock setup and Nancy's vintage synth cables continues...

Artist Interview | Mike Honcho | Glitter

An in-depth artist interview with Mike Honcho (Mike Dodakian) about his new album Glitter, released on Ingrown Records. This Boston-based electronic artist shares insights into his creative process, equipment setup, and the influences behind his unique blend of lo-fi, downbeat, and experimental sounds.

From his equipment arsenal including the Elektron Digitone and MFB Tanzbar to his love of film soundtracks and polyrhythmic explorations, Mike opens up about making music by ear and the chaos-meets-control approach that defines his sound.

Nine Inch Nails | Peel It Back Tour 2025

A somewhat short review of Nine Inch Nails' performance at Barclays Center, Brooklyn, New York on the Peel It Back Tour 2025. From crooning Reznor to brooding industrial chaos, this show was a sensory assault in the best way possible.

With opener Boyz Noize setting the glitchy tone, NIN delivered everything fans wanted: classics like Wish and Heresy mixed with deep cuts and experimental lighting that scrambled your brain. 11 out of 10 for energy, showmanship, and effort.
